This two day course is suitable for a complete beginner.
We will take you through the different stages of building a modern footstool.
This is a two day course suitable for a complete beginner.
We will take you through the different stages of re-upholstering a dining chair.
This four day course is aimed at someone with a little upholstery experience.
We will enable you to build a traditional style footstool.
This three and a half day course is suitable for a beginner to upholstery and someone with a little sewing experience.
We will guide you through the processes to make a lampshade, piped cushion and modern footstool.
This is a flexible course for someone wishing to work on their own project, but who isn’t able to attend on a weekly basis.
We recommend someone starting with a level one course before embarking on your own project.
We run morning and afternoon classes on Tuesdays through to Thursdays for anyone wishing to come on a regular basis.
Each session is three hours long and we run these classes throughout the year.

At Mary’s Chairs we are keen to recycle and reuse as many chairs and footstools as possible. We have for the past 8 years offered a chair rehoming service. If you have a chair that is suitable for reupholstery and you no longer have a use for it we will “foster” your chair until a new home can be found. This is dependant on our available storage space and whether the chair will lend itself to reupholstery. Please email us with a photo of your chair if you would like to us to consider adoption.
